## Specifications

| Parameter | Value |
|---|---|
| Weight | 3.85kg |
| Pack Quantity | 1 |
| Product Range | VRLA |
| External Depth | 151mm |
| External Width | 98mm |
| Battery Voltage | 12V |
| External Height | 94mm |
| Battery Capacity | 12Ah |
| Battery Terminals | Quick Connect |
| Battery Technology | Lead Acid |
